The registry allows pet owners whose animals have been microchipped to register cats and dog, update their contact details, report missing pets, transfer ownership and pay lifetime registration fees all from a computer or mobile. Each chip has a unique number that is detected using a microchip scanner. If your dog or cat was microchipped elsewhere and you move to nsw, you will need to register your pet in nsw.

Modern microchips are about the size of a grain of rice and are implanted beneath the animal's skin between the shoulders. Once your pet's microchip is registered, your contact information will be accessible at the national pet microchip registration database for as long as you own your pet. You can now update your contact details on the new nsw pet registry. In nsw, all cats and dogs, other than exempt cats and dogs, must be microchipped by 12 weeks of age or before being sold. Once the vet enters the microchip details on the nsw pet registry the owner can immediately go online, create a profile and claim their pet.

The nsw pet registry website was launched in july 2016 as part of the government’s commitment to promoting responsible pet ownership and improved animal welfare outcomes.
